Unraveling the Mysteries of 13

Ever wondered why the number 13 holds such power in the biker community? Well, buckle up, because I’m about to spill the beans on this fascinating piece of biker lore. In the outlaw circles, 13 is more than just a numberβ€”it’s a symbol of defiance and loyalty. Legend has it that the number 13 represents the Original 13 outlaw motorcycle clubs that boldly broke away from the confines of the AMA (American Motorcycle Association) to carve out their own path on the open road.

The Mongols Connection

Now, let’s dive deeper into the mystique surrounding the number 13 in biker culture. In the folklore of outlaw motorcycle clubs, 13 is often associated with the Mongols MC, one of the most notorious biker gangs in the world. Why, you ask? Well, it’s quite simpleβ€”the 13th letter of the alphabet is β€˜M,’ and as we all know, the Mongols MC proudly flaunts their connection to this powerful symbol through the number 13.

The Mother Chapter

But wait, there’s more to the story of 13 in biker culture. Beyond its ties to the Mongols MC, the number 13 can also symbolize the Mother chapter within many 1% clubs or be worn by loyal support clubs as a mark of respect and allegiance. When a biker proudly sports the 13 patch, it’s not just a fashion statementβ€”it’s a bold declaration of their rebellious spirit, unwavering loyalty, and deep roots in the outlaw motorcycle club.
